According to the provided financial data, Q2 Holdings has maintained a steady revenue growth trajectory, recording a 14.1% year-over-year increase in 2026Q1, which suggests that the company is successfully scaling its core-neutral digital banking platform despite the inherent complexities of the regional financial institution market.
The consistent double-digit growth indicates that the company's value proposition remains relevant to RCFIs seeking modernization without core replacement. Investors should monitor whether this growth rate can be sustained as the company reaches higher penetration levels within its target tier-2 and tier-3 banking segments.
As reported in the income statement, Q2 Holdings has achieved a notable expansion in gross margins, climbing from 49.7% in 2024Q1 to 59.1% by 2026Q1, which implies improved efficiency in cloud infrastructure management and a favorable shift in the mix toward higher-margin software subscription revenue.
This margin expansion is a critical indicator of the company's ability to leverage its platform as it scales. The trend suggests that the company is successfully managing the variable costs associated with legacy system integrations, though further gains may be harder to capture as the platform matures.
Based on the quarterly figures, Q2 Holdings has demonstrated significant operating leverage, with operating income swinging from a $14.2M loss in 2024Q1 to a $28.1M profit in 2026Q1, indicating that revenue growth is now outpacing the expansion of core operating expenses like R&D and SG&A.
The company appears to have moved past the most intensive phase of its investment cycle, allowing for meaningful bottom-line contribution. This transition suggests that management's focus on GAAP profitability is yielding tangible results, though the sustainability of this leverage depends on continued discipline in overhead spending.
Data from recent filings reveals that Q2 Holdings continues to utilize significant stock-based compensation, with $20.3M recorded in 2026Q1, which warrants careful scrutiny as it represents a substantial portion of the company's operating income and may dilute the quality of reported GAAP earnings for shareholders.
While the company is achieving GAAP profitability, the reliance on equity-based incentives to attract specialized fintech talent remains a persistent feature of the cost structure. Investors should evaluate whether this compensation level is necessary for retention or if it masks the true economic cost of maintaining the platform's competitive edge.
